Offline PAN Card Application


The applicant can also apply for a PAN card using an offline approach. They can go to a nearby TIN centre and complete the following steps:








Form is available for download and printing. You can get a copy of the form here.




/downloads/pan/download/e-Gov 0)




Fill out the form and attach a passport-size photograph.




Pay the fee by demand draught made out to '– PAN' and payable in Mumbai.




With the form, include a self-attested proof.




On the envelope of the application form, write 'APPLICATION FOR PAN—Acknowledgement Number.' The application must be addressed to the following address:

When applying for a PAN card, there is a fee.


The fee for applying for a card that needs to be sent to an Indian address is Rs. 110/-, while the fee for applying for a new PAN that needs to be sent outside India is Rs. 1020/-. (inclusive of the). Fees can be paid by demand draught, credit card, or debit net banking in the name of '-PAN.'

PAN Card Application Requires Proof of Date of Birth




a copy of any of the following documents indicating the applicant's name and date of birth








Unique Identification Authority issues cards




Voter identification card




Passport




a driver's licence




Birth certificate issued by a local body or entity authorised by the Registrar of Births and Deaths or the Indian Consulate to issue a birth certificate




A certificate or a mark sheet is a document that certifies that a person has completed




The state or central government, or any public sector undertaking, may issue a photo identity card with the name DOB.




The certificate of domicile issued by the




Ex-servicemen Contributory Health Scheme photo card provided by the Central Government Health Scheme




Order for Payment of Pensions




The Registrar issues a marriage certificate.




An affidavit of date of birth was acquired.
